Call Of Death

Watch out!

Because there's a zombie invasion, and someone is pretty pissed off about that. It's Dirty Dick Johnson, and we are proud to show you his new game named "Call of Death: Chapter one". It's a complete indy production, we are currently looking for publisher and are evaluating online distribution platforms.

YOUR MISSION:
You are Dirty Dick Johnson, a guy who doesn't care about anything but girls'n booze. But since the Pussy Palace, Big City's nr. 1 adress for first class adult dancing entertainment couldn’t open because of the zombie invasion, you'll have to make your way out into the city to bring back all the lost strippers. There might be some zombies in your way...

GAME FACTS:
* A fast paced first person SHOTER with a lot of action, hot babes and really black humor
* Easy accessable arcade gameplay, cinematic kill scenes and countless gallons of zombie blood to be shed
* Weapon shop with 12 weapons and a lot of additional items to be purchased
* 5 levels / 3 versions to play each map / 3 mini games to be revealed throughout the game
* 1st of 3 planned chapters
